West Virginia High School Basketball - Summers County ripped by James Monroe
February 21, 2023: Lindside, WV 24951 The James Monroe Mavericks basketball team scored 69 points and held the visiting Summers County Bobcats to 45 in the Mavericks non-league triumph on Tuesday.
The Mavericks now sport a 19-2 record. They put it on the line next when they travel to River View for a Coalfield A contest on Friday, February 24. James Monroe will meet a Raiders team coming off a 70-60 non-league loss to Midland Trail (Hico, WV). The Raiders record now stands at 9-11.
The Bobcats (10-10) will now prepare for their contest against Montcalm (Montcalm, WV). The Generals enter the non-league contest with a 11-7 record. In their last contest, Montcalm was routed by Sherman (Seth, WV), 61-56, in a non-league contest.
